Between Friends

No-kill shelter throws killer sale

The only thing worse than a slacker is one who doesn't watch the entirety of The Price Is Right. (Talkin' to you, negligent pet owners.) Maybe you just wanted to catch Plinko, or maybe you flip the channel the instant a Showcase Showdown winner is announced, but you keep missing Bob Barker's message at every episode's end—spay and neuter your pets. At the very least, the Treasured Friends no-kill shelter at 3556 Ridgebriar Drive picks up the slack around Dallas, but it needs your help finding homes for stray puppies and kittens, so help out by visiting its expansive summer garage sale from 8 a.m. to 6 p.m. Friday and from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m. Saturday.
